Transaction 9c112de69c2e24e8214aaf2b1a2d894d35b3ed78221aeb27ac9c16417fa4ac1d
1 Input
1 Output
-
9c112de69c2e24e8214aaf2b1a2d894d35b3ed78221aeb27ac9c16417fa4ac1d:0
- value
- 10574041
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f589baf005ea4fae8f785e38dde2530e1897bdf
- address
- bc1qeavfhtcqt6j0468hsh3cmh39xrscj77lrf0wcz